页面加载中…
通过率 0% · 提交 0 · 通过 0
给定一个原本升序、但在某个未知位置旋转后的无重复数组 nums 和目标值 target,请输出 target 的下标;若不存在,输出 -1。下标从 0 开始。
这题属于站内 OJ 练习中的「旋转数组二分」方向。建议先自己提交一遍,卡住时再看动画确认核心思路。
第一行输入两个整数 n 和 target。第二行输入 n 个整数,表示旋转排序数组 nums。
输出 target 的 0-based 下标,若不存在输出 -1。
示例 1
输入示例
7 0 4 5 6 7 0 1 2
输出示例
4
0 位于下标 4。
时间限制 2000 ms · 内存限制 256 MB